Full job description
Key Responsibilities
• Under the guidance of the engineering manager, design, develop, and test hydraulic systems for various applications
• Plan and execute engineering tasks for project components or moderately complex standalone projects.
• Conduct calculations and simulations to validate system performance
• Select appropriate materials and develop bills of materials (BOMs), technical drawings, and test plans.
• Collaborate with cross-functional teams to ensure project success
• Provide technical support to clients and resolve issues
• Prepare technical reports and presentations to communicate project results
• Stay up to date with industry trends and advancements in hydraulic technology
• Provide guidance to technicians during fabrication.
• Manage the project to schedule, communicate potential delays, and advise with recovery plans
Essential Functions:
• Prepare hydraulic and electrical schematics and develop manuals for startup and maintenance.
• Perform engineering calculations for pressure, flow, and heat removal to support system design.
• Provide layout and schematic drawings to fabrication technicians and for final documentation.
• Contribute to project management by:
• Monitoring and updating project budgets.
• Recommending and implementing change orders with customer approval.
• Coordinating with subcontractors to maintain project schedules.
• Providing on-site technical support and field supervision.
• Maintaining documentation and collecting field test data to meet submittal requirements.
• Attending project meetings and coordinating with all stakeholders.
• Support proposal development and provide engineering input for assigned projects.
• Offer technical support to sales teams, parts coordinators, shop personnel, and fellow engineers on component selection, system layout, and fabrication practices.
• Assist with part substitutions to meet delivery timelines and troubleshoot issues during testing.
• Follow and support continuous improvement of Business Management System (BMS) procedures and work instructions.
• Perform other related duties as assigned.
Qualifications:
•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ical, Electrical, or Systems Engineering
• Knowledge interpreting technical drawings and schematics.
• Familiarity with AutoCAD and Inventor is considered an asset.
• Effective communication, organizational, and problem-solving skills.
• Ability to manage multiple projects and collaborate with cross-functional teams.
